Secret Dragon Fruit Care Tips From a Master Dragon Fruit Grower
Soil & Water
- Drainage is Crucial: Sandy loam with high organic matter is ideal; poor drainage leads to root rot.
- Watering: Water regularly to keep soil moist, especially when fruiting, but allow it to dry slightly between waterings.
Support & Planting
- Support Structure: Essential as it's a climbing cactus; use sturdy posts or trellises, guiding the plant to grow upwards.
- Planting Cuttings: Use 20-25cm stem cuttings, planting during July-August.
Care & Maintenance
- Fertilizing: Feed monthly during spring/summer with balanced fertilizer; reduce in cooler months.
- Pruning: Pinch the top once it reaches 1-1.5m to encourage branching and cascading growth, which makes harvesting easier.
- Pollination: Most varieties self-pollinate, but flowers open at night.
Harvesting
- When to Pick: Harvest when the fruit pulls free easily with a gentle twist and the "scales" start to wither.
